GPU comparison with benchmarksThe ASRock Intel Arc A380 Challenger ITX 6GB OC has 1024 shader units and these clock a maximum of 2.25 GHz which results in an FP32 computing power of 4.10 TFLOPS.
The ASUS Dual GeForce GTX 1650 (GDDR6) has 896 shader units and these clock at a maximum of 1.62 GHz and achieve an FP32 computing power of 2.90 TFLOPS. |

GPUThe ASRock Intel Arc A380 Challenger ITX 6GB OC is equipped with a graphics chip of the Alchemist architecture, which has 128 streaming multiprocessors. The graphics card ASUS Dual GeForce GTX 1650 (GDDR6) is based on the Turing architecture and is equipped with 14 execution units. |

MemoryThe ASRock Intel Arc A380 Challenger ITX 6GB OC is equipped with a 6 GB large GDDR6 graphics memory, which is equipped with 1.938 GHz clocks. The ASUS Dual GeForce GTX 1650 (GDDR6) has a 4 GB large GDDR6 graphics memory and the memory clock is 1.500GHz. |

Thermal DesignThe ASRock Intel Arc A380 Challenger ITX 6GB OC has 1 x 8-Pin connectors through which it is supplied with power. The manufacturer specifies the maximum operating temperature of the graphics card as Unknown. The ASUS Dual GeForce GTX 1650 (GDDR6) is equipped with a 1 x 6-Pin PCIe power connector that supplies it with power. The maximum operating temperature of the card is 92 °C. |

Additional dataManufactured using the 6 nanometer process, ASRock Intel Arc A380 Challenger ITX 6GB OC was released in Q3/2022. The ASUS Dual GeForce GTX 1650 (GDDR6) published in Q4/2021 is manufactured with a structure width of 12 nanometers. |
